The 2022/23 UEFA Champions League group stage draw will take place today, August 25. The draw ceremony is being held in Istanbul, Turkey.

Twenty-six teams qualified automatically for the Champions League group stage via their 2021/22 league position, while six further teams booked their places via the play-offs.

The POTS

  • Pot 1: Ajax, Bayern Munich, Eintracht Frankfurt, Man City, AC Milan, PSG, Porto, Real Madrid

  • Pot 2: Atletico Madrid, Barcelona, Chelsea, Juventus, Liverpool, RB Leipzig, Sevilla, Tottenham

  • Pot 3: Benfica, Borussia Dortmund, Inter Milan, Bayer Leverkusen, Napoli, Salzburg, Shakhtar Donetsk, Sporting

  • Pot 4: Celtic, Club Brugge, Copenhagen, Maccabi Haifa, Marseille, Viktoria Plzen, Rangers, Dinamo Zagreb

0 - Liverpool have never previously faced Rangers in a competitive match. The Reds’ only previous European Cup/Champions League meeting with a Scottish opponent was in the 1980-81 last 16, beating Alex Ferguson’s Aberdeen 5-0 on aggregate en route to winning the title. First.

3 - Each of the last three European meetings between Chelsea and Milan have been drawn, with their last coming in the 1999-00 Champions League first group stage. Throwback.

8 - Man City have won each of their last eight Champions League home games against German opponents; those eight games have seen a combined 39 goals, with the Citizens scoring 30 and conceding nine. Expectant.
